Battery Energy Storage System Market Competitive Landscape

The growing global emphasis on renewable energy generation, particularly from solar and wind sources, is a major driver of the battery energy storage system (BESS) market. Unlike conventional power plants, renewables are inherently intermittent—solar energy is unavailable at night, and wind power fluctuates with weather conditions. This inconsistency creates grid stability challenges. Battery energy storage systems address these issues by storing surplus energy generated during peak production and releasing it when demand exceeds supply. This capability not only ensures uninterrupted power delivery but also enhances grid flexibility, supports renewable expansion, and enables countries to achieve their decarbonization and energy transition goals.

One of the most influential factors fueling the global BESS market is the steady decline in battery production costs, especially for lithium-ion technologies. Advances in materials science, manufacturing automation, and economies of scale driven by the electric vehicle (EV) boom have drastically reduced per-kilowatt-hour prices.

The BESS market is evolving beyond hardware, as integrators strategically differentiate via vertical integration, AI-enabled dispatch software, and regional manufacturing investments. For instance, Tesla’s Megapack dominance stems from its vertically integrated supply chain and rapid feature rollouts, while Fluence leverages proprietary bidding and project execution software that supports major utilities. BYD capitalizes on low-cost LFP modules in Asian tenders, undercutting competitors. Meanwhile LG Energy bundles hardware with long-term service contracts for reliability. Natron Energy and Form Energy focus on sodium-ion and iron-air chemistries to carve niche roles in data centers and long-duration storage. The increasing deployment of solar and wind power is a primary driver for Battery Energy Storage Systems (BESS). These energy sources are intermittent and variable, making grid stability a challenge. BESS helps store excess energy during peak production and dispatch it when demand is high or supply is low. This ability to smoothen power fluctuations enhances energy reliability, supports renewable energy integration, and reduces curtailment, driving demand for large-scale storage solutions across developed and developing nations.

Shift Toward Long-Duration Energy Storage: The market is witnessing a significant trend toward long-duration battery energy storage systems (LD-BESS) that can store energy for 8 to 100+ hours. Technologies like iron-air and flow batteries are gaining traction as they address intermittency challenges posed by renewable energy sources. These solutions are critical for grid resiliency, especially in regions with high renewable penetration and variable demand cycles.
